The Early Days: Basic Webcam Tables

In the early 2000s, online casinos relied almost entirely on RNG-based games. While convenient, many players missed the authenticity of physical casino tables.


To address this, early live casinos introduced:

  • Single webcam streams

  • Static camera angles

  • Limited dealer interaction

  • Basic chat functions

The video quality was often grainy, and stream stability depended heavily on internet speeds at the time.


Even so, the concept proved popular because it introduced real human dealers into online gaming.


Improved Streaming Technology

As broadband internet improved globally, live casino platforms upgraded their infrastructure.


Key developments included:

  • Faster video encoding

  • Reduced latency

  • Clearer audio

  • More stable connections

This phase marked the shift from novelty to mainstream acceptance.


Live tables began to feel smoother and more responsive, reducing delays between bets and results.


Multi-Camera & HD Streaming Era

The next major leap was the introduction of:

  • HD video quality

  • Multiple camera angles

  • Close-up views of cards and roulette wheels

  • Professional studio lighting


These improvements enhanced transparency and trust.


Players could clearly see:

  • Card shuffles

  • Ball spins

  • Dealer actions

This level of visibility strengthened confidence compared to early streaming setups.

Transparency & Player Trust

Live streaming casinos help address concerns about fairness.


Because players can visually observe:

  • Cards being dealt

  • Wheels spinning

  • Dice rolling

The perception of control and authenticity increases.


While RNG systems are mathematically fair, some players feel more confident when they see physical outcomes unfold in real time.
